As a Junior Logistician for the Naval Supply Systems Command (NAVSUP) , you will play a critical role in the Navy's Hazardous Material Management (HMM) program. Your work will directly support Pollution Prevention (P2) and Hazardous Material Control and Management (HMC&M) goals—reducing hazardous waste generation and lowering disposal costs through efficient life-cycle management.
CHRIMP Support: Facilitate the implementation and operational sustainment of the Consolidated Hazardous Material Reutilization and Inventory Management Program (CHRIMP) for both Ashore and Afloat units.
Compliance Oversight: Ensure adherence to federal, state, and local environmental regulations, including OSHA statutes, the Pollution Protection (P2) Act, and the Emergency Planning and Community Right to Know Act (EPCRA).
Inventory & Lifecycle Management: Execute procedures for HAZMAT identification, segregation, storage, and shelf-life management. Oversee material offload and turn-in for reuse or disposal.
Assessments & Tools: Conduct HAZMAT Locker Assessments and utilize specialized tools such as Authorized Use Lists (AUL), Safety Data Sheets (SDS), and Automated Information Technology (AIT).
System Sustainment: Support the deployment and sustainment of HAZMAT IT systems, specifically Navy ERP , to maintain high inventory accuracy.
